Dell XPS 9350 swollen battery and out of warranty
Hi,
I've got a Dell XPS 9350 and the last 2-3 months, I had a bump that gently created itself on the keyboard, I guess it is the battery that has a problem. This also affected the screen, as the keyboard was not flat anymore, I've got spots with dead pixels.
My laptop is sadly out of warranty and my only option when I go to the support is to call the support, but as I bought the computer in Switzerland, it is in German, which I don't speak fluently enough to be able to handle such a discussion.
First of all, did other people had similar problems? What did you do? And do you have any other options I could use to fix this?

bschubert,
You must use the "out of warranty support" from the original country that you purchased it in. Or use the XPS 13-9350 Service Manual and remove the battery yourself. Then, use the XPS 13-9350 with the power AC adapter by itself until you can reach the "out of warranty support" from the original country of purchase.
